会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
pqdl4312
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
2024年10月17日
【Springboot】注解EqualsAndHashCode
摘要: 先看问题,如图所示 注解解释 @EqualsAndHashCode 作用与子类上 callSuper = true,根据子类自身的字段值和从父类继承的字段值来生成hashcode,当两个子类对象比较时,只有子类对象的本身的字段值和继承父类的字段值都相同,equals方法的返回值是true。 call
阅读全文
posted @ 2024-10-17 09:17 飘去荡来
阅读(425)
评论(0)
推荐(0)
2024年10月15日
Java在for循环中修改集合
摘要: 前天看到一篇文章什么?for循环也会出问题?,里面涉及到在for循环中修改集合,想起来自己刚入行的时候就碰到过类似的问题,于是复现了一下文章中的问题,并试验了其它在循环中修改集合的方法。 底层原理参考什么?for循环也会出问题?这篇文章的分析 1. 在fori中修改集合 在fori中修改集合,不会抛
阅读全文
posted @ 2024-10-15 17:29 飘去荡来
阅读(127)
评论(0)
推荐(0)
java 不建议使用stack
摘要: Java不建议使用Stack的原因和替代方案 在Java编程中,Stack类通常用于处理数据结构中的堆栈实现。然而,随着Java的发展,越来越多的开发者开始质疑是否应该继续使用Stack类。本文将探讨不建议使用Stack的原因,示例代码,以及推荐的替代方案。 Stack类简介 在Java中,Stac
阅读全文
posted @ 2024-10-15 17:23 飘去荡来
阅读(141)
评论(0)
推荐(0)
【JAVA】ifPresent 的使用
摘要: 在 Java 中,ifPresent 是一个用于 Optional 类型的方法,用于检查 Optional 对象中是否存在值并执行相应的操作。ifPresent 方法接受一个 Consumer 函数式接口作为参数,如果 Optional 对象中包含值,则将该值传递给 Consumer 接口的实现方法
阅读全文
posted @ 2024-10-15 17:16 飘去荡来
阅读(700)
评论(0)
推荐(0)
Java中Collections.singletonList的使用
摘要: 在Java中,Collections.singletonList 是一个用于创建包含单个元素的不可变列表(Immutable List)的实用方法。这个方法返回一个只包含指定对象的列表,该列表是不可修改的,即不能添加、删除或修改其中的元素。 以下是使用 Collections.singletonLi
阅读全文
posted @ 2024-10-15 17:06 飘去荡来
阅读(1039)
评论(0)
推荐(0)
java8的reduce方法
摘要: 在 Java 8 中,reduce 是一个流操作方法,用于将流中的元素按照指定的操作进行归约(reduce)操作,最终得到一个结果。 reduce 方法有三种重载形式: T reduce(T identity, BinaryOperator<T> accumulator)这个方法接受一个初始值 id
阅读全文
posted @ 2024-10-15 17:04 飘去荡来
阅读(242)
评论(0)
推荐(0)
2024年10月14日
idea 自动添加注释 (方法+类 带参数/返回值)
摘要: 1.类自动注释 左上角选择 File -> Settings -> Editor -> File and Code Templates, 选择Files -> Class,在类声明上填入以下内容,并勾选Enable Live Templates 开启此模板 其中${}为变量,可以使用默认自带的变量,
阅读全文
posted @ 2024-10-14 10:58 飘去荡来
阅读(4749)
评论(0)
推荐(0)
禅道的安装和使用
摘要: 禅道的安装和使用 </h1> <div class="clear"></div> <div class="postBody"> <div id="cnblogs_post_body" class="blogpost-body blogpost-body-html"> 安装 1.选择安装地址,安装路径
阅读全文
posted @ 2024-10-14 09:45 飘去荡来
阅读(91)
评论(0)
推荐(0)
2024年10月10日
解决使用Navicat连接数据库时,打开数据库表很慢的问题
摘要: 今天使用Navicat连接数据库时,发现不管表中数据多少,打开数据库表非常慢。 解决方法: Navicat - 右键编辑数据库连接 - 高级 - 勾选保持连接间隔 - 输入框设置为20 - 点击确定! 参考文章:https://51.ruyo.net/14030.html
阅读全文
posted @ 2024-10-10 17:06 飘去荡来
阅读(396)
评论(0)
推荐(0)
【JDK1.8】JDK1.8新特性
摘要: 1.Java 8 lamda Stream的Collectors.toMap参数 使用toMap()函数之后,返回的就是一个Map了,自然会需要key和value。 toMap()的第一个参数就是用来生成key值的,第二个参数就是用来生成value值的,第三个参数用在key值冲突的情况下,如果新元素
阅读全文
posted @ 2024-10-10 16:46 飘去荡来
阅读(487)
评论(0)
推荐(0)
上一页
1
2
公告